Filtros de destinatário para listas de endereços no PowerShell do Exchange Online
Os filtros de destinatário identificam os destinatários incluídos em listas de endereços e GALs. Há duas opções básicas: filtros de destinatário predefinidos e filtros de destinatário personalizados. Essas são basicamente as mesmas opções de filtragem de destinatário que são usadas por grupos de distribuição dinâmicos e políticas de endereço de email.
Filtros de destinatários predefinidos
Usa o parâmetro IncludedRecipient necessário com o
AllRecipients
valor ou um ou mais dos seguintes valores:MailboxUsers
,MailContacts
,MailGroups
,MailUsers
ouResources
. Vários valores, separados por vírgulas, podem ser especificados.Você também pode usar qualquer um dos parâmetros de filtro condicional opcionais: ConditionalCompany, ConditionalCustomAttribute[1to15], ConditionalDepartment e ConditionalStateOrProvince.
Você especifica vários valores para um parâmetro condicional usando a sintaxe
"<Value1>","<Value2>"...
. Vários valores da mesma propriedade implicam o operador ou . Por exemplo, "Departamento é igual a Vendas, Marketing ou Finanças".Filtros de destinatário personalizados: usa o parâmetro RecipientFilter necessário com um filtro OPATH.
A sintaxe básica do filtro OPATH é
"<Property1> -<Operator> '<Value1>' <Property2> -<Operator> '<Value2>'..."
.Aspas
" "
duplas são necessárias em torno de todo o filtro OPATH. Embora o filtro seja uma cadeia de caracteres{ }
(não um bloco do sistema), você também pode usar chaves , mas somente se o filtro não contiver variáveis que exigem expansão.Hifens (
-
) são necessários antes de todos os operadores. Aqui estão alguns dos operadores mais usados:and
,or
enot
.eq
ene
(é igual e não é igual; não é sensível a casos).lt
egt
(menor e maior que).like
enotlike
(a cadeia de caracteres contém e não contém; requer pelo menos um curinga na cadeia de caracteres. Por exemplo,"Department -like 'Sales*'"
.Use parênteses para agrupar
<Property> -<Operator> '<Value>'
instruções em filtros complexos. Por exemplo,"(Department -like 'Sales*' -or Department -like 'Marketing*') -and (Company -eq 'Contoso' -or Company -eq 'Fabrikam')"
. O Exchange armazena o filtro na propriedade RecipientFilter com cada instrução individual entre parênteses, mas você não precisa inseri-los dessa forma.Para obter mais informações, consulte Informações adicionais de sintaxe OPATH.
Para obter mais informações sobre listas de endereços, consulte Listas de endereços no Exchange Online.
Para procedimentos de lista de endereços que usam filtros de destinatário, consulte Procedimentos de lista de endereços no Exchange Online.